When you look at dental bills, the final amount depends on several variables. The biggest factors are the complexity of the procedure and the materials used, such as whether a crown is porcelain or gold. If you have insurance, that impacts your out-of-pocket share, while those paying cash might see different rates based on the office's overhead. A dentist is a skilled healthcare provider focused on your oral well-being. They are trained to diagnose, treat, and prevent conditions affecting your teeth, gums, and mouth. Wisdom teeth are often cited as the most difficult to extract due to their location and potential for impaction. The complexity of the procedure can vary significantly from person to person.
